Microsoft disrupts Fox Tempest malware-signing service

Microsoft disrupted Fox Tempest, a malware-signing-as-a-service operation that abused Microsoft's Artifact Signing service to create fraudulent code-signing certificates used by ransomware gangs and cybercriminals. The disruption involved seizing infrastructure, taking down virtual machines, and unsealing a legal case in U.S. District Court.
